Supersymmetric U(1) at the TeV Scale
Abstract
If there exists an arbitrary supersymmetric U(1) gauge factor at the TeV scale, under which the two Higgs superfields H_{1,2} of the standard model are nontrivial, and if there is also a singlet superfield S such that the H_1 H_2 S term is allowed in the superpotential, then the structure of the two-doublet Higgs sector at the electroweak scale is more general than that of the MSSM (Minimal Supersymmetric Standard Model). Under further assumptions of grand unification and universal soft supersymmetry breaking terms, the scale of U(1) breaking is related to the parameter tan(beta) = v_2/v_1.
